remove LetterImageTemplate

This commit is contained in:
Kenneth Kehl
2025-03-31 11:13:48 -07:00
parent 722ae3b00b
commit e956b19616
2 changed files with 1 additions and 28 deletions

View File

@@ -17,11 +17,7 @@ from notifications_utils.recipients import (
Row,
first_column_headings,
)
from notifications_utils.template import (
EmailPreviewTemplate,
LetterImageTemplate,
SMSMessageTemplate,
)
from notifications_utils.template import EmailPreviewTemplate, SMSMessageTemplate
def _sample_template(template_type, content="foo"):
@@ -30,11 +26,6 @@ def _sample_template(template_type, content="foo"):
{"content": content, "subject": "bar", "template_type": "email"}
),
"sms": SMSMessageTemplate({"content": content, "template_type": "sms"}),
"letter": LetterImageTemplate(
{"content": content, "subject": "bar", "template_type": "letter"},
image_url="https://example.com",
page_count=1,
),
}.get(template_type)

View File

@@ -2144,24 +2144,6 @@ def test_text_messages_collapse_consecutive_whitespace(
)
# def test_letter_preview_template_lazy_loads_images():
# page = BeautifulSoup(
# str(
# LetterImageTemplate(
# {"content": "Content", "subject": "Subject", "template_type": "letter"},
# image_url="http://example.com/endpoint.png",
# page_count=3,
# )
# ),
# "html.parser",
# )
# assert [(img["src"], img["loading"]) for img in page.select("img")] == [
# ("http://example.com/endpoint.png?page=1", "eager"),
# ("http://example.com/endpoint.png?page=2", "lazy"),
# ("http://example.com/endpoint.png?page=3", "lazy"),
# ]
def test_broadcast_message_from_content():
template = BroadcastMessageTemplate.from_content("test content")